In … st francis hospital in federal way waWebAug 21, 2024 · Consider a situation in which one halogen (chlorine, for example) is reacted with the ions of another (iodide, perhaps) from a salt solution. In the chlorine and iodide ion case, the reaction is as follows: (1) Cl 2 + 2 I − → 2 Cl − + I 2 The iodide ions lose electrons to form iodine molecules.
